diff --git a/kolla/common/config.py b/kolla/common/config.py index d00d265e2b..0067d106da 100644 --- a/kolla/common/config.py +++ b/kolla/common/config.py @@ -156,115 +156,115 @@ SOURCES = { 'openstack-base': { 'type': 'url', 'location': ('http://tarballs.openstack.org/requirements/' - 'requirements-master.tar.gz')}, + 'requirements-stable-newton.tar.gz')}, 'aodh-base': { 'type': 'url', 'location': ('http://tarballs.openstack.org/aodh/' - 'aodh-master.tar.gz')}, + 'aodh-3.0.0.tar.gz')}, 'barbican-base': { 'type': 'url', 'location': ('http://tarballs.openstack.org/barbican/' - 'barbican-master.tar.gz')}, + 'barbican-3.0.0.tar.gz')}, 'bifrost-base': { 'type': 'url', 'location': ('http://tarballs.openstack.org/bifrost/' - 'bifrost-master.tar.gz')}, + 'bifrost-2.1.0.tar.gz')}, 'ceilometer-base': { 'type': 'url', 'location': ('http://tarballs.openstack.org/ceilometer/' - 'ceilometer-master.tar.gz')}, + 'ceilometer-7.0.0.tar.gz')}, 'cinder-base': { 'type': 'url', 'location': ('http://tarballs.openstack.org/cinder/' - 'cinder-master.tar.gz')}, + 'cinder-9.0.0.tar.gz')}, 'congress-base': { 'type': 'url', 'location': ('http://tarballs.openstack.org/congress/' - 'congress-master.tar.gz')}, + 'congress-4.0.0.tar.gz')}, 'cloudkitty-base': { 'type': 'url', 'location': ('http://tarballs.openstack.org/cloudkitty/' - 'cloudkitty-master.tar.gz')}, + 'cloudkitty-0.6.1.tar.gz')}, 'designate-base': { 'type': 'url', 'location': ('http://tarballs.openstack.org/designate/' - 'designate-master.tar.gz')}, + 'designate-3.0.0.tar.gz')}, 'glance-base': { 'type': 'url', 'location': ('http://tarballs.openstack.org/glance/' - 'glance-master.tar.gz')}, + 'glance-13.0.0.tar.gz')}, 'gnocchi-base': { 'type': 'url', 'location': ('http://tarballs.openstack.org/gnocchi/' - 'gnocchi-master.tar.gz')}, + 'gnocchi-3.0.0.tar.gz')}, 'heat-base': { 'type': 'url', 'location': ('http://tarballs.openstack.org/heat/' - 'heat-master.tar.gz')}, + 'heat-7.0.0.tar.gz')}, 'horizon': { 'type': 'url', 'location': ('http://tarballs.openstack.org/horizon/' - 'horizon-master.tar.gz')}, + 'horizon-10.0.0.tar.gz')}, 'horizon-plugin-neutron-lbaas-dashboard': { 'type': 'url', 'location': ('http://tarballs.openstack.org/neutron-lbaas-dashboard/' - 'neutron-lbaas-dashboard-master.tar.gz')}, + 'neutron-lbaas-dashboard-1.0.0.tar.gz')}, 'ironic-base': { 'type': 'url', 'location': ('http://tarballs.openstack.org/ironic/' - 'ironic-master.tar.gz')}, + 'ironic-6.2.1.tar.gz')}, 'ironic-inspector': { 'type': 'url', 'location': ('http://tarballs.openstack.org/ironic-inspector/' - 'ironic-inspector-master.tar.gz')}, + 'ironic-inspector-4.2.0.tar.gz')}, 'keystone-base': { 'type': 'url', 'location': ('http://tarballs.openstack.org/keystone/' - 'keystone-master.tar.gz')}, + 'keystone-10.0.0.tar.gz')}, 'kuryr-base': { 'type': 'url', 'location': ('http://tarballs.openstack.org/kuryr/' - 'kuryr-master.tar.gz')}, + 'kuryr-lib-0.1.0.tar.gz')}, 'kuryr-libnetwork': { 'type': 'url', - 'location': ('http://tarballs.openstack.org/kuryr-libnetwork/' - 'kuryr-libnetwork-master.tar.gz')}, + 'location': ('http://tarballs.openstack.org/kuryr/' + 'kuryr-lib-0.1.0.tar.gz')}, 'magnum-base': { 'type': 'url', 'location': ('http://tarballs.openstack.org/magnum/' - 'magnum-master.tar.gz')}, + 'magnum-3.1.1.tar.gz')}, 'manila-base': { 'type': 'url', 'location': ('http://tarballs.openstack.org/manila/' - 'manila-master.tar.gz')}, + 'manila-3.0.0.tar.gz')}, 'mistral-base': { 'type': 'url', 'location': ('http://tarballs.openstack.org/mistral/' - 'mistral-master.tar.gz')}, + 'mistral-3.0.0.tar.gz')}, 'murano-base': { 'type': 'url', 'location': ('http://tarballs.openstack.org/murano/' - 'murano-master.tar.gz')}, + 'murano-3.0.0.tar.gz')}, 'neutron-base': { 'type': 'url', 'location': ('http://tarballs.openstack.org/neutron/' - 'neutron-master.tar.gz')}, + 'neutron-9.0.0.tar.gz')}, 'neutron-lbaas-agent': { 'type': 'url', 'location': ('http://tarballs.openstack.org/neutron-lbaas/' - 'neutron-lbaas-master.tar.gz')}, + 'neutron-lbaas-9.0.0.tar.gz')}, 'neutron-sfc-agent': { 'type': 'url', 'location': ('http://tarballs.openstack.org/networking-sfc/' - 'networking-sfc-master.tar.gz')}, + 'networking-sfc-2.0.0.tar.gz')}, 'neutron-vpnaas-agent': { 'type': 'url', 'location': ('http://tarballs.openstack.org/neutron-vpnaas/' - 'neutron-vpnaas-master.tar.gz')}, + 'neutron-vpnaas-9.0.0.tar.gz')}, 'nova-base': { 'type': 'url', 'location': ('http://tarballs.openstack.org/nova/' - 'nova-master.tar.gz')}, + 'nova-14.0.0.tar.gz')}, 'nova-spicehtml5proxy': { 'type': 'url', 'location': ('http://github.com/SPICE/spice-html5/tarball/' @@ -276,35 +276,35 @@ SOURCES = { 'rally': { 'type': 'url', 'location': ('http://tarballs.openstack.org/rally/' - 'rally-master.tar.gz')}, + 'rally-0.6.0.tar.gz')}, 'sahara-base': { 'type': 'url', 'location': ('http://tarballs.openstack.org/sahara/' - 'sahara-master.tar.gz')}, + 'sahara-5.0.0.tar.gz')}, 'senlin-base': { 'type': 'url', 'location': ('http://tarballs.openstack.org/senlin/' - 'senlin-master.tar.gz')}, + 'senlin-2.0.0.tar.gz')}, 'swift-base': { 'type': 'url', 'location': ('http://tarballs.openstack.org/swift/' - 'swift-master.tar.gz')}, + 'swift-2.10.0.tar.gz')}, 'tempest': { 'type': 'url', 'location': ('http://tarballs.openstack.org/tempest/' - 'tempest-master.tar.gz')}, + 'tempest-13.0.0.tar.gz')}, 'trove-base': { 'type': 'url', 'location': ('http://tarballs.openstack.org/trove/' - 'trove-master.tar.gz')}, + 'trove-6.0.0.tar.gz')}, 'watcher-base': { 'type': 'url', 'location': ('http://tarballs.openstack.org/watcher/' - 'watcher-master.tar.gz')}, + 'python-watcher-0.31.0.tar.gz')}, 'zaqar': { 'type': 'url', 'location': ('http://tarballs.openstack.org/zaqar/' - 'zaqar-master.tar.gz')} + 'zaqar-3.0.0.tar.gz')} }